Light therapy helps to treat post-operative wounds

Post-operative wounds can be slow to heal, with swelling, redness, and oozing often reported for some time after surgery. While following a strict wound cleaning regime and finishing any prescribed antibiotics is essential, often some extra help is needed to speed up the healing process.

Light therapy has shown several benefits when used for surgical wounds:

The wound area receives more oxygen and nutrients to help with the natural wound healing process.

Light therapy promotes lymph system activity – this helps with detoxification of the wound without overtaxing the lymph system and prevents lymphoedema.

Light rays clean up dead cells: boosted blood circulation helps with cleaning up dead or damaged cells, including dead bacteria.

It promotes collagen production – as proven in many studies, red light waves stimulates collagen and elastin production in the final wound healing phases.

It helps release ATP (raw cellular energy) which gives energy to the damaged cells in the wound so they can heal better and faster (study).
